FERRIER HOLDINGS LIMITED
SC085006 - Incorporated on 11 October 1983
MR MR2 LTD
11218539 - Incorporated on 21 February 2018
MR & MR LTD
16489396 - Incorporated on 2 June 2025
DING-GOES LIMITED
SC330247 - Incorporated on 3 September 2007
OKIA DING LIMITEDActive - Proposal to Strike off
07316276 - Incorporated on 15 July 2010
DING DIGITAL LIMITED
08514363 - Incorporated on 2 May 2013
AI DING LIMITEDDisolved
12875690 - Dissolved on 15 February 2022
DING ADVERTISING LIMITEDDissolved
11337108 - Dissolved on 8 October 2019
DING LIMEHOUSE LTDActive - Proposal to Strike off
12083821 - Incorporated on 3 July 2019
DING INVESTMENT LTD
14927268 - Incorporated on 9 June 2023
HAIHUA DING LTDDisolved
NI707855 - Dissolved on 8 October 2024
YINGYING DING LTDDisolved
NI709180 - Dissolved on 15 October 2024
DING RECRUITERS LIMITEDDisolved
15466222 - Dissolved on 8 July 2025
A. DINGWALL LTD.
SC250022 - Incorporated on 23 May 2003
DINGO LUKE LTDDissolved
06038695 - Dissolved on 6 July 2010
DINGA NICA LTDDisolved
NI710749 - Dissolved on 25 February 2025
DINGYBOO LTD
16318985 - Incorporated on 16 March 2025
MR MR LTDActive - Proposal to Strike off
15533685 - Incorporated on 1 March 2024
NIGEL LAWRENCE LIMITED
02510651 - Incorporated on 11 June 1990
NOWTHRIVE LIMITEDDissolved
09736720 - Dissolved on 3 September 2019